-
-
Notifications
You must be signed in to change notification settings - Fork 132
Closed
Labels
enhancementNew feature or requestNew feature or request
Description
Please try answering few of those questions
- Why we need this improvement?
As form the discussion on the cli issue [FEATURE] Reduce number of dependencies and install size (v2.17 needs 1700 dependencies, takes 1.7Gb of space) cli#1752 and as per investigation in
same the bundling and package size of the studio is huge and thus increasing the overall size of other projects
using it as dependency. - How will this change help?
Reduce the overall package size to improve space and installation process.
Description
Please try answering few of those questions
- What changes have to be introduced?
Bundling and release pipelines needed to be updated to include only the required packages. - Will this be a breaking change?
No - How could it be implemented/designed?
Some reference :- https://nextjs.org/docs/app/guides/package-bundling
Metadata
Metadata
Assignees
Labels
enhancementNew feature or requestNew feature or request
Type
Projects
Status
Done